Output 81bda05b25bb94477b0d7b50d73d2ebfe887111eac9d9ed9d505c3d27ee5efeb:2

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24be2e422ec6f22e555c45f8a3363eed18e48a52 OP_EQUAL
address
353J5SFVUTdyHKMvJYh1zdhyLguu1pfwpP
transaction
81bda05b25bb94477b0d7b50d73d2ebfe887111eac9d9ed9d505c3d27ee5efeb
confirmations
298734
spent
true